Overview

ACC ALN faculty standing in front of the Wake Forest University StadiumThe ACC Academic Leaders Network (ALN) is designed to facilitate cross-institutional networking and collaboration among academic leaders while building leadership capacity for the participating institutions. Participants are typically faculty leaders who have received foundational leadership training and who have at least one to two years of experience in their current leadership role, such as department chairs or heads, assistant or associate deans, and assistant or associate provosts. The program consists of three on-site sessions over the course of the calendar year, each hosted at a different participating university campus. These sessions are designed to build leadership awareness and effectiveness in the context of higher education and facilitate conversations over a range of topics that support leadership growth in key areas across multiple spheres of influence. On-site sessions will include content and discussion designed to further knowledge and skills of intra- and interpersonal leadership styles, building leadership capacity, navigating complex challenges in higher education, and collaborating on complex challenges for leaders in academia.

Travel information

Two airports are convenient to the SMU campus. The larger airport, DFW, is the American Airlines hub and has a greater number of direct flights. It is approximately 30–40 minutes from the SMU campus. The smaller airport, Dallas Love Field, is much closer to campus (a 10–15 minute drive); Love Field is the main hub for Southwest Airlines. Both are very good options depending on connections from your originating airport.

Transportation to/from each airport is easiest with any rideshare company or taxi. Public transportation is not an efficient option. Your hotel is within walking distance (literally across the street) from the SMU campus. We do not recommend renting a car unless you plan to extend your stay to discover Dallas (which we do recommend!) If you do rent a car, please note that there is a hotel charge for parking of approximately $45/day.
